FSS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

177 of the 3,446 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Federal Signal (FSS)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$695M — down 9.5% from $768M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 17 funds opened new FSS positions and 14 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 55 added to existing stakes and 74 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Copper Rock Capital Partners, adding an estimated $5.28M. The largest seller was Norges Bank, cutting an estimated $6.54M.
